June Weather in Bunbury, Australia

Last updated: February 25, 2025

June in Bunbury, Australia offers a pleasant blend of temperatures and moderate rainfall, making it a cozy month for visitors. With a maximum temperature reaching 23°C (73°F) and an average of 14°C (57°F), the days can be comfortably warm, while the nights may dip to a cooler 5°C (41°F). Rainfall is noteworthy, with 120 mm (4.7 in) over approximately 12 days, contributing to a humidity level of 77% that enhances the lush surroundings. June Precipitation in Bunbury

In Bunbury, June marks a significant peak in rainfall, with precipitation soaring to 120 mm (4.7 in) over 12 rainy days. This sharp increase follows the steady rise observed in May, which saw 80 mm (3.1 in), hinting at the onset of winter's wet season. As temperatures cool, the city experiences a marked transition into its rainiest months, with July following closely behind at 145 mm (5.7 in) over 16 days. June Winds in Bunbury

In June, Bunbury experiences a mild wind speed of 4.1 m/s (9 mph), marking a slight uptick from the preceding months of April and May, which hovered around 3.5 to 3.7 m/s. This gentle breeze is part of a seasonal pattern where wind speeds start to pick up as winter approaches, leading into the stronger gusts of July, which typically sees an average of 5.9 m/s (13 mph).
